A method of manufacturing porous moulded bodies in which crushed crystaline silicate material is mixed with alkali silicates in the ratio of 2-6:1, the mixture containing 15 percent water by weight of dried substance. The mixture is heated in a closed vessel affording a constant volume system at 140 DEG -500 DEG C so as to avoid the vapour phase and produce a transformation product which is then dried, crushed and heated, if necessary with additives. There is also provided a device for heating the crushed transformation product, the device comprising a bell-type furnace with a hearth plate on which a stack of moulds is placed, an annealing bell having heating elements removably disposed over the hearth plate and a further cooling cap over the hearth plate. |
